Low-power display for mobile use in sunlight
DISPLAY VISIONS is presenting an exceptionally economical yet high-contrast col-our display for professional mobile use at the embedded world 2025 trade fair.
At the upcoming embedded world 2025, DISPLAY VISIONS is showcasing its sun-light-readable, low-power TFT024-23ATNN colour display for mobile use. In addition to its switchable backlight, this transflective TFT panel also makes use of outdoor light for display purposes. This means the TFT024-23ATNN can also deliver a sharp and high-contrast display in direct sunlight. In poor lighting conditions, the backlight, with approximately 270 cd/m², helps to improve the readability.
Supplied with 3.3 V, the power consumption of the compact colour display without a backlight is an economical 10 mA. Based on an eight-hour working day, this is equivalent to an energy requirement of just under 80 mAh. This makes the TFT024-23ATNN ideal for installation in mobile devices.
The resolution of the colour display, which is 43 mm wide, 60 mm high and only 3 mm thick, is 240x320 RGB pixels. Its background is white and the content can be displayed in either colour or black. As an alternative to the standard RGB interface, the TFT024-23ATNN can also be controlled on a PIN-sparing basis via a 4-wire SPI interface or a parallel µC data bus with 8 or 16 bits. A service life of 50,000 operating hours and reliable operation between
-20° and +70°C underscore the great performance of the TFT024-23ATNN for pro-fessional use. DISPLAY VISIONS also guarantees long-term availability and full support.
